Which plant structure is responsible for gas exchange with the atmosphere?
Stomata are responsible for gas exchange with the atmosphere.What gases do stomata exchange with the atmosphere?
Stomata exchange carbon dioxide and oxygen with the atmosphere.How do stomata regulate gas exchange?
Stomata can open and close to regulate gas exchange.What happens when stomata are closed?
When stomata are closed, they do not allow gas exchange with the atmosphere.What is the primary function of stomata in plant leaves?
The primary function of stomata is to regulate gas exchange.Which gases are involved in the process regulated by stomata?
The gases involved are carbon dioxide and oxygen.What is the role of stomata in photosynthesis?
Stomata allow carbon dioxide to enter the leaf, which is essential for photosynthesis.How does the opening and closing of stomata affect a plant's water loss?
When stomata are open, water can evaporate from the leaf, leading to water loss.What is the relationship between stomata and the plant's atmosphere interaction?
Stomata facilitate the interaction between the plant and the atmosphere by allowing gas exchange.What is the significance of stomata in maintaining homeostasis in plants?
Stomata help maintain homeostasis by regulating gas exchange and water loss.How do stomata contribute to the plant's adaptation to its environment?
Stomata can open and close in response to environmental conditions, aiding in the plant's adaptation.What is the role of stomata in the plant's respiration process?
Stomata allow oxygen to exit and carbon dioxide to enter, which is crucial for respiration.How do stomata affect the plant's photosynthetic efficiency?
By regulating the intake of carbon dioxide, stomata directly impact the plant's photosynthetic efficiency.What is the impact of stomata on the plant's water use efficiency?
Stomata control water loss through transpiration, affecting the plant's water use efficiency.How do stomata contribute to the plant's overall health and growth?
By regulating gas exchange and water loss, stomata play a crucial role in the plant's overall health and growth.
